If you're finding the deck doesn't have legs in your meta, start swapping in mana rocks to help out, as Fiddler suggested. My deck only works because there isn't enough spot removal in my meta to take out Krenko before he's made a ton of goblins. By then, I'll have Ashnod's Altar, Phyrexian Altar, or Skirk Prospector out. Treasonous Ogre is another great way to eke out a late game Krenko.
Are you running my version of the list or your own? Let me take a look and I can make suggestions for improving. If you find Krenko draws a lot of removal, you'll need to rework your strategy some.
Another thing you can do is not cast Krenko until you can protect him or use him immediately. Casting him off a Cavern of Souls with a haste enabler and other parts on board can win a game on the spot. With regards to spot removal, you can also wait until Krenko is targeted, then use his ability in response and go off; this will at least draw two removal spells from an opponents hand in order to stop you from comboing.

It's definitely not better than Faithless Looting. That card is really powerful, and you can get a lot out of it - especially because you're drawing before discarding. So if you had five cards in hand, you draw two, and then choose which of the seven you need least.
The challenge with Cathartic Reunion is whether or not you have two extra cards to pitch late game. You'll usually have one, but two? I just need to experiment with it more to see. There have been times where I've got a hand full of mountains late game that I would definitely have appreciated the ability to filter through. But there are other times where I'm just top decking and it would take two more turns of bad draws to be useful. I'll have to play around and see which scenario is more likely. With Grenzo, this might actually be less of a problem as I'll be top decking off of everyone's decks, lol.

I've played with Chandra in other decks. She has a certain inevitability with her ultimate. I was thinking Chandra doesn't really help the goblin swarm, but actually, I think she might be decent. Your opponents will need flyers to get past your chump blockers, so you can tick her up each time, doing red-style card draw or just shocking opponents, ramping if needed. It really challenges opponents to take her out.
The downside, her ultimate says target opponent, not all opponents. And if you ult her, the whole table is going to try and knock you out quick.
I know people don't usually measure planeswalkers by their ultimates in EDH, but I don't cast walkers unless I can protect them usually, and this deck has a strong ground game. If you have an extra one, could be worth a test slot at least.

Paradox Engine seems like a worthy card for testing. I’m only hesitant because I don’t find myself casting too many spells unless I’m dropping my combo and winning that turn. The nice thing is, we don’t have to go infinite to win a game with Krenko. If I can get one in trade, I’ll try it out too.
If you have a critical mass of mana rocks and a buyback spell (such as Shattering Pulse, Fanning the Flames, or Haze of Rage) then you could potentially combo off. Haze of Rage is particularly interesting as you can swing for infinite damage with a haste enabler pumping all the tokens.

Sacrificing a creature is different from a creature being destroyed. A sacrificed creature isn't destroyed, and regenerate only defends against destruction. A sacrificed creature simply dies.

BUT, that’s not to say there isn’t potential infinite combos using the Engine. Skirk Prospector + Cloudstone Curio + Paradox Engine + Krenko, Mob Boss is infinite. Any haste enabler could replace Paradox Engine. On a side note, Mogg War Marshal or Siege-gang Commander works in the combo without the need for the Engine.
If you have a critical mass of mana rocks and a buyback spell (such as Shattering Pulse, Fanning the Flames, or Haze of Rage) then you could potentially combo off. Haze of Rage is particularly interesting as you can swing for infinite damage with a haste enabler pumping all the tokens.
Isochron Scepter + any ritual (Brightstone Ritual and Battle Hymn generally finding a way into the deck anyway) will allow us to go infinite with Paradox Engine. I generally don’t want to run Isochron Scepter with only one or two cards to potentially imprint, but it’s a combo.
